  • Patent number: 11357098
    Abstract: A high-speed serial computer expansion bus circuit topology, comprises: a first signal path connecting between a first interface and a second interface, a second signal path connecting between the first interface and a third interface, a third signal path connecting between the third interface and a fourth interface, a first selector circuit having a first passive element and a second passive element which are respectively disposed in the first signal path and the second signal path, a second selector circuit having a third passive element and a fourth passive element which are respectively disposed in the second signal path and the third signal path. The second signal path is conducted when the first passive element and the second passive element are conducted, the third signal path is conducted when the third passive element and the fourth passive element are conducted.

  • Publication number: 20220069756
    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a fan management method and system, and a server. The method includes: monitoring working performance of each dual-motor fan in real-time; determining whether the working performance of the dual-motor fan is normal, if the working performance is normal, instructing the dual-motor fan to continue to operate with normal performance; if the working performance is not normal, instructing a single-motor fan that has no abnormality in the dual-motor fan to operate with a preset compensation strategy; the preset compensation strategy is a strategy for performing performance compensation for a single-motor fan that has no abnormality to normal performance of a dual-motor fan. The present disclosure can reduce energy consumption of the server, avoid ineffective waste, and save operating costs. The fan can be prevented from running at a high speed for a long time, and the service life of the fan can be improved.

  • Patent number: 11093017
    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a method for automatically optimizing power consumption. The method includes: (S1) a baseboard management controller determines whether system information is correct or not after powered on. If correct, further proceeding the method. If not correct, stopping further proceeding the method. (S2) the baseboard management controller periodically detects the surface temperature and the internal temperature of the essential element with a first loop cycle and determines whether the surface temperature or the internal temperature is higher than a preset temperature. (S3) If the surface temperature or the internal temperature is higher than the preset temperature, performing a PID adjustment to the fan rotation speed according to the surface temperature or the internal temperature of the essential element.

  • Publication number: 20210136957
    Abstract: The disclosure provides a heat dissipation device. The heat dissipation device is configured to dissipate heat generated by a central process unit. The heat dissipation device includes a first heat dissipation component, at least one second heat dissipation component and at least one heat pipe. The at least one heat pipe is connected to the first heat dissipation component and the at least one second heat dissipation component, the first heat dissipation component is configured to be correspondingly disposed at a side of the central processing unit.
